SSL_CONNECTION_GET_SSL
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*s = SSL_CONNECTION_GET_SSL(sc);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
return ssl_undefined_function(SSL_CONNECTION_GET_SSL(sc));
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L_get_security_level(SSL_CONNECTION_GET_SSL(s)));
const SSL_CIPHER *c = SSL_CONNECTION_GET_SSL(s)->method->get_cipher_by_char(ptr);
if (SSL_dane_tlsa_add(SSL_CONNECTION_GET_SSL(to), t->usage,
return ssl_undefined_function(SSL_CONNECTION_GET_SSL(sc));
return ssl_undefined_function(SSL_CONNECTION_GET_SSL(sc));
return ssl_undefined_function(SSL_CONNECTION_GET_SSL(sc));
scts = SSL_get0_peer_scts(SSL_CONNECTION_GET_SSL(s));
return ssl_undefined_function(SSL_CONNECTION_GET_SSL(sc));
do_sslkeylogfile(SSL_CONNECTION_GET_SSL(sc), (const char *)out);
return ssl_undefined_function(SSL_CONNECTION_GET_SSL(sc));
SSL_CONNECTION_GET_SSL(s)->method->ssl3_enc->set_handshake_header((s), (pkt), (htype))
SSL_CONNECTION_GET_SSL(s)->method->ssl3_enc->close_construct_packet((s), (pkt), (htype))
#define ssl_do_write(s) SSL_CONNECTION_GET_SSL(s)->method->ssl3_enc->do_write(s)
(SSL_CONNECTION_GET_SSL(s)->method->ssl3_enc->enc_flags & SSL_ENC_FLAG_DTLS)
&& SSL_CONNECTION_GET_SSL(s)->method->version >= TLS1_3_VERSION \
&& SSL_CONNECTION_GET_SSL(s)->method->version != TLS_ANY_VERSION)
(SSL_CONNECTION_GET_SSL(s)->method->ssl3_enc->enc_flags & SSL_ENC_FLAG_SIGALGS)
(SSL_CONNECTION_GET_SSL(s)->method->ssl3_enc->enc_flags & SSL_ENC_FLAG_TLS1_2_CIPHERS)
if ((s->session != NULL) && !(s->shutdown & SSL_SENT_SHUTDOWN) && !(SSL_in_init(SSL_CONNECTION_GET_SSL(s)) || SSL_in_before(SSL_CONNECTION_GET_SSL(s)))) {
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
if (!CRYPTO_THREAD_read_lock(SSL_CONNECTION_GET_SSL(s)->lock))
ss->timeout = SSL_CONNECTION_GET_SSL(s)->method->get_timeout();
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
clnt = SSL_get_srtp_profiles(SSL_CONNECTION_GET_SSL(s));
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
cipher = SSL_CIPHER_find(SSL_CONNECTION_GET_SSL(s),
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
cipher = SSL_CIPHER_find(SSL_CONNECTION_GET_SSL(s),
version = SSL_version(SSL_CONNECTION_GET_SSL(s));
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
|| (SSL_get_options(SSL_CONNECTION_GET_SSL(s))
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
if (!ssl_cipher_list_to_bytes(s, SSL_get_ciphers(SSL_CONNECTION_GET_SSL(s)),
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(sc);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
rbio = SSL_get_rbio(SSL_CONNECTION_GET_SSL(s));
if (ssl3_renegotiate_check(SSL_CONNECTION_GET_SSL(s), 1)) {
if (BIO_dgram_is_sctp(SSL_get_wbio(SSL_CONNECTION_GET_SSL(s)))) {
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
|| BIO_dgram_is_sctp(SSL_get_wbio(SSL_CONNECTION_GET_SSL(s)))
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
switch (SSL_CONNECTION_GET_SSL(s)->method->version) {
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
const S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
BIO_ctrl(SSL_get_wbio(SSL_CONNECTION_GET_SSL(s)),
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L_CONNECTION_GET_SSL(s))
if (SSL_get_options(SSL_CONNECTION_GET_SSL(s)) & SSL_OP_COOKIE_EXCHANGE) {
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
|| !SSL_CONNECTION_GET_SSL(s)->method->put_cipher_by_char(s->s3.tmp.new_cipher,
rbio = SSL_get_rbio(SSL_CONNECTION_GET_SSL(s));
if (SSL_export_keying_material(SSL_CONNECTION_GET_SSL(s),
if (!SSL_CONNECTION_GET_SSL(s)->method->ssl3_enc->change_cipher_state(s,
&& (SSL_get_options(SSL_CONNECTION_GET_SSL(s)) & SSL_OP_COOKIE_EXCHANGE)) {
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
retcb = s->session_ctx->decrypt_ticket_cb(SSL_CONNECTION_GET_SSL(s),
&& SSL_CONNECTION_GET_SSL(s)->method->version == TLS_ANY_VERSION
sk = SSL_get_ciphers(SSL_CONNECTION_GET_SSL(s));
if (TLS1_get_version(SSL_CONNECTION_GET_SSL(s)) >= TLS1_2_VERSION
if (TLS1_get_version(SSL_CONNECTION_GET_SSL(s)) >= TLS1_2_VERSION)
sec_level_bits = ssl_get_security_level_bits(SSL_CONNECTION_GET_SSL(s),
if (TLS1_get_version(SSL_CONNECTION_GET_SSL(sc)) == SSL3_VERSION) {
if (str == SSL_CONNECTION_GET_SSL(s)->method->ssl3_enc->server_finished_label) {
SSL *ssl = SSL_CONNECTION_GET_SSL(s);
if (!TEST_int_gt(SSL_get_handshake_rtt(SSL_CONNECTION_GET_SSL(s), &rtt), 0))